在IronPython2.6下运行PyBonjour时,出现错误:OSError:IronPython.Runtime.Exception.OSException:cannotloadlibrarylibdns_sd.so.1这源于一行:ctypes.cdll.LoadLibrary(_libdnssd)其中_libdnssd是“libdns_sd.so.1”我在系统上安装了Apple分发的所有Bonjour工具。有人知道如何解决这个问题吗? 最佳答案 我的猜测是PyBonjour有一个类似于sys.platform=='win32
我在Hadoop集群中遇到一个问题。我有一个包含5个数据节点和一个边缘/网关节点的Hadoop集群。我的问题是我必须在每个节点(1个名称节点和5个数据节点)中启动历史服务器,以从hadoopwebUI获取任何提交作业的作业历史记录。我在mapred-site.xml中添加了mapreduce.jobhistory.address和mapreduce.jobhistory.webapp.address但我猜它不能正常工作。如果我仅在名称节点或任何其他节点中启动历史服务器,HadoopClusterWeb-UI将无法向我显示作业历史记录并以一些错误结束。我的映射站点XMLmapred.jo
我正在使用Spark提交通过YARN运行spark作业,在我的spark作业失败后,作业仍显示状态为SUCCEED而不是FAILED。如何将退出代码作为失败状态从代码返回到YARN?我们如何从代码中发送yarn不同的应用程序代码状态? 最佳答案 我认为你做不到。我在spark-1.6.2上遇到过同样的行为,但在分析失败后,我没有看到任何明显的方法可以从我的应用程序发送“错误”退出代码。 关于scala-Sparkyarn返回退出代码未更新,因为webUI中失败-spark提交,我们在St
我试过这个:publicStringgetFilename(){Filefile=newFile(Environment.getExternalStorageDirectory(),"Test2");if(!file.exists()){file.mkdirs();}StringuriSting=(file.getAbsolutePath()+"/"+"IMG_"+System.currentTimeMillis()+".png");returnuriSting;}我尝试将第二行更改为:Filefile=newFile("sdcard/Test2");但目录仍然是在设备存储中创建的,而
根据我所阅读的所有内容,让应用程序可移动到SD所需要做的就是将以下行添加到list中:android:installLocation="preferExternal"我尝试将此添加到我公司的两个应用程序中,虽然移动选项出现在两个应用程序的设置中,但实际上只有一个可以成功移动。当按下另一个应用程序的移动按钮时,它会尝试移动,然后弹出“无法移动”消息。我能够找到错误的实际文本,但没有太大帮助:“MOVE_FAILED_INTERNAL_ERROR”我认为这可能是因为失败的应用程序中嵌入了C代码。作为一项测试,我尝试移动AndroidStudio为常规Android应用程序和内置C++支持的
我想在ListView中显示sdcard中的歌曲,但它会强制关闭。任何人都可以帮助我吗?代码:packagecom.ex.imageGallery;importjava.io.File;importandroid.app.Activity;importandroid.content.Intent;importandroid.graphics.drawable.ColorDrawable;importandroid.net.Uri;importandroid.os.Bundle;importandroid.os.Environment;importandroid.view.View;im
我希望在Android2.2中以编程方式删除用户的整个SD卡。最简单的方法是什么?是否需要root权限?我可以只执行“rm-rf/mnt/sdcard”还是必须进行递归循环? 最佳答案 您可以使用Java删除目录。如果它们不为空,则必须递归执行此操作:http://www.exampledepot.com/egs/java.io/DeleteDir.html没有。所有应用程序都具有对外部存储的完全RW访问权限。是的,您可以执行shell命令(但您必须检查“rm”是否可用):Anywaytorunshellcommandsonandr
我能够下载一个apk文件并将其存储在我的/data/data/com.android.myApp/anotherApp.apk中。我想知道是否有办法从另一个应用程序安装此文件。我目前正在使用:Intentintent=newIntent(Intent.ACTION_VIEW);intent.setDataAndType(Uri.parse(filepath),"application/vnd.android.package-archive");startActivity(intent);这是我的list文件:当我运行这个。它给我“解析错误:解析包时出现问题”。我不知道问题是什么?1)我
尝试在我的应用程序中实现导入和导出功能。导出只是将文件复制到SD卡中。我已经完成了,但是导入有点问题。因为导入应该删除以前的而不是我正在使用的当前数据库并加载以前的数据库。我浏览了该站点上有关从应用程序中的sd卡导入sqlite数据库的各种帖子。Importingdatabase,这里有一个答案,但我想知道什么时候调用这个方法。?或任何其他解决方案。将不胜感激! 最佳答案 我觉得这个link将帮助您找到解决方案,基本上您必须检查list文件中是否包含读取和写入外部存储设备的权限,然后按照教程进行操作。
我使用了以下example将我的数据库导出到SD卡。我可以在SD卡上创建文件,但内容是空的。我已经检查过我可以从我的数据库文件中读取并且可以写入SD源。在我的传输方法中捕获到异常,但消息是nulllogcat没有显示有关异常的任何进一步信息。知道为什么数据没有传输到目标文件吗?publicbooleantransferFile(Filesrc,Filedest){booleanflag=false;FileChannelinChannel=null;;FileChanneloutChannel=null;if(!dest.canWrite()){Log.d(TAG,"unabletow